Video from Dundee City Council

Teachers and parents can learn how to help children be more active by watching a video produced by Dundee City Council. Mike Watson, minister for tourism, culture and sport, said, 'The video is an excellent example of the kind of joined-up approach needed to tackle obesity and inactivity in children. The Scottish Executive has increased funding for the Active Primary School programme from 1.3m per annum to a total of Pounds 16m over the next three years. This underlines our commitment to promoting physical activity as an essential element in improving the health of the nation.'
